Date:
Friday May 4th 2018
Venue:
Maryborough
Time:
2:30pm - 5:00pm
Mission:
To make 2 Star Wars fans very happy on their special day by adding Redback awesomeness to the wedding.
Trooper Attendance:
Baytrooper
BigDub
Donut
Firestorm
MyKill
Teiwaz
Tempus_Redux
Details:
Sam & Trish are massive Star Wars fans and wanted to add a special touch to their wedding. What better way than to have the Redback's there.
3 shuttles converged on the locations mid afternoon and proceeded to scope the area for a hold bay. As per usual, the command shuttle arrived after the first 2 had landed, as per protocol in the Wide Bay procedures manual.
One of the shuttles had made a very long journey to attend, carrying 3 committed and much appreciated troopers.
Whilst in a holding pattern waiting for the bride to arrive, the troopers rehearsed their parade duties and captured a few quick holopics.
There was a lot of LOVE TIEing everything together with Firestorm making his debut as a fully fledged TIE Pilot.
Whilst waiting for the bride to arrive, Tempus_Redux reminded MyKill of his duties.
The bride arrived and then was escorted to the alter by the troopers, who then stood guard as she walked down the aisle.
After the ceremony, the troopers posed for many, many holopics with the happy couple and their guests.
After posing for all the pics, Baytrooper and Tempus_Redux commandeered a local form and transport (The rarely seen AT-EMu) and were making their war back to the docking bay when Baytrooper spotted the bride getting ready to throw the bouquet.
Tempus was a little "concerned" with Baytrooper's choice of transport.
We made it safely to compete for the bouquet.
Tempus_Redux must have used some sort of "Force Leap" to get it. He let us all know about it too.
Charity Funds Raised: $501 being donated to the Redbacks Hervey Bay Relay for Life Team.
Injuries / Malfunctions: Nil
Public Incidents: N/A
Mission Status:
Massive success. Lots of fun had by all. Again, a big thank you to Teiwaz for commanding the shuttle that made the trip up from Brisbane way, bringing with him Donut and MyKill.
